Paris police have shot dead a knife-wielding man wearing a fake suicide belt who tried to enter a police station shouting "Allahu Akbar" (God is Great). The incident occurred as Parisians were rembering those killed in the Charlie Hebdo attacks one year ago. Nathan Frandino reports.

A woman administrator was stabbed to death by a Tunisian man at a police station southwest of Paris on Friday, the local prosecutor's office and a police source told AFP. The attacker, a Tunisian, was fatally wounded when officers opened fire on him at the station in Rambouillet, a wealthy commuter town 60 kilometres (40 miles) from Paris, a police source told AFP on condition of anonymity.
